Belajar PHP Part 25 : Go To Operator

got to

  • Salah Satu fitur yang sebenarnya  jarang sekali digunakan di PHP adalah goto operator
  • Kenapa jarang digunakan, karena jika terlalu banyak menggunakan goto operator, kode program aplikasinya akan mudah membingungkan yang membaca kode nya
  • goto adalah fitur dimana kita bisa loncat ke kode program sesuai dengan keinginan kita
  • Agar goto bisa loncat ke kode program, kita harus membuat label di php dengan menggunakan nama label lalu diakhiri : (colon)

Go To Sederhana

goto a;
echo "Hello World" . PHP_EOL;

a:
echo "Hello A" . PHP_EOL;

go to sederhana

Saat kita menjalankan kode diatas secara otomatis akan menampilkan "Hello A", Kok Kenapa tidak menampikan "Hello Word" ?

Karena ada operator go to di bagian baris pertama kode yaitu goto a; dimana tersambung dengan a:

Go To Kompleks

$counter = 1;

while (true) {
    echo "Ini adalah for while ke-$counter" . PHP_EOL;
    $counter++;

    if ($counter > 10) {
            goto end;
    }
}

end:
echo "End Loop";

go to kompleks

Next Post Previous Post
No Comment
Add Comment
comment url